Understanding the Zowie ZA13-CW Design

The ZA13-CW features an ambidextrous shape with a symmetrical design, making it suitable for both right- and left-handed users. Its lightweight construction and textured grips contribute to comfort, but individual adjustments can further enhance usability.

Key Ergonomic Adjustments

1. Proper Mouse Placement

Position the mouse so that your wrist is in a neutral position, not bent up or down. The mouse should sit comfortably under your hand with your fingers naturally resting on the buttons.

2. Adjust Your Grip

Use a grip style that minimizes tension. The claw grip or relaxed palm grip can reduce fatigue. Avoid gripping too tightly, which can cause strain over time.

3. Customize DPI Settings

Set the DPI to a level that allows precise movements without requiring excessive wrist motion. Typically, 800 to 1600 DPI is suitable for most tasks, but adjust according to personal preference.

4. Use Proper Surface

Place the mouse on a smooth, consistent surface such as a mouse pad designed for optical mice. An uneven surface can cause unnecessary strain and inaccuracies.

Additional Ergonomic Tips

  • Take regular breaks to stretch your hand and wrist muscles.
  • Maintain an ergonomic desk setup with your monitor at eye level.
  • Ensure your chair supports good posture, with feet flat on the floor.
  • Adjust your armrest height to support your forearm comfortably.
  • Keep your wrist straight and avoid resting it on hard surfaces while using the mouse.
